Chose this place because reviews said it was good for families and we were dining with an almost 3-year-old. Their kids menu has a combination of Mexican plates and some traditional American kid menu items (chicken nuggets, burger, etc.). The adult menu was quite large and included a double-sided picture reference which actually encouraged both adults to try something we might not have otherwise. The place has booths around the walls and tables with chairs in the center of the room. The booth was nice for keeping the toddler in place. There were a few tvs on playing sports, but I didn't even notice them at first. They had several non-alcoholic beer choices available, and I ordered a frozen margarita. Our server (I believe their name was Aril) was awesome. He was great interacting with the toddler, helpful with our menu questions, and he was very friendly. The food and beverages were all wonderful. Main courses and guacamole were 5 stars, but I wish my rice had been seasoned more and the fried ice cream shell was very thin. I would return. My husband and I were in the mood for tacos and wanted to go somewhere new for them. I ordered a two taco combo and he decided on a chalupa and chili relleno combo. I expected authentic Mexican food but what was received could only be described as slightly better than taco bell. My taco shells looked/tasted store bought. My husband got the biggest chalupa in the world as a full sized flour tortilla, like the kind from the grocery store used for wraps, was fried and shaped like the letter L. It was too big/crispy to pick up and was very messy so had to be eaten with a fork/knife like a taco salad. He also received an enchilada instead of his original order.

A fantastic local, family run Mexican restaurant. This was my second visit and can confidently say it’s an authentic and quality family-style Mexican restaurant. Food was spectacular, I had the Asada Monterray, which came with came with bacon-wrapped prawns, sautĆ©d with veggies and covered in cheese (BOMB). Portions are legit and food comes out piping hot and fresh. Salsa is made in house and is delicious and definitely got a kick to it šŸŒ¶ļø Service has been great both times, waiters are personable and helpful in making decisions. Next to the food, the atmosphere is what makes this place a 5 star. It’s a small, cozy vibe, but filled with life and color. It feels authentically Mexican, but fresh, clean, and modern. I appreciated the volume level of the music not being so loud you can’t talk to your dinner party. Oh, and did I mention the drinks are šŸ”„ definitely recommend the cantarito!!! Will be back for a third time and look forward to trying more of the delicious, and hard-to choose-from menu.

Went for dinner tonight with my Girlfriend, and we were both very pleased with our experience. Personally I really dug the apparent regulars welcomed vibe as we saw quite a few people clearly well known and that’s something I’d enjoy when in that position. Arroz con pollo was the dish chosen by the girlfriend and she loved it! Tell ya ya what, it looked tasty too! I went with the #29 which was a combo of 1 chimichanga, 1 taco, & 1 enchilada. Like a good traditional Mexican restaurant does we were serve a heavy portion. We also enjoy a couple 16oz house margaritas that tasted wonderful in their big plump glasses. We will definitely be back to taste more of the menu. Thank you for the very friendly service.
